Warren M. Cox is a scholar working on Animal Science and Zoology, Nutrition and Dietetics and Surgery. According to data from OpenAlex, Warren M. Cox has authored 6 papers receiving a total of 72 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 3 papers in Animal Science and Zoology, 2 papers in Nutrition and Dietetics and 1 paper in Surgery. Recurrent topics in Warren M. Cox’s work include Animal Nutrition and Physiology (3 papers), Rabbits: Nutrition, Reproduction, Health (2 papers) and Vitamin C and Antioxidants Research (1 paper). Warren M. Cox is often cited by papers focused on Animal Nutrition and Physiology (3 papers), Rabbits: Nutrition, Reproduction, Health (2 papers) and Vitamin C and Antioxidants Research (1 paper). Warren M. Cox collaborates with scholars based in United States. Warren M. Cox's co-authors include A. J. Mueller, Heinz Herrmann, L. J. Filer, A. Leonard Sheffner, Herbert P. Sarett, Daniela Gallo and Francis G. McDonald and has published in prestigious journals such as PEDIATRICS, The Journal of Pediatrics and Experimental Biology and Medicine.
